Transaction 1942995737ee220a528a1e7d155f6b3ef88996501cf19d5c817cd81fa470bc70

1 Input
2 Outputs
  • 1942995737ee220a528a1e7d155f6b3ef88996501cf19d5c817cd81fa470bc70:0
  • value  2421
    address  12ERT9yJxEwsWHNuXLjFDzXCehRno3BBuk
  • 1942995737ee220a528a1e7d155f6b3ef88996501cf19d5c817cd81fa470bc70:1
  • value  17858804
    address  35Po4EsPdZH7bNovKif6QQ57JYU8mAfoA5